It looks like a good deal for the tranny, their motors are pretty good, there are some issues with the bigger strokers and pistons binding but for the most part you don't hear a lot of crap about them online.

I would bet it's a revtech clone, the price at $600 is a steal. Beats Bakers $3K box.
